Foam Jacking in West Des Moines, IA

Foam jacking is a technique used to lift and level sunken or uneven concrete surfaces, such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ors. This process involves injecting a specialized foam material beneath the affected area to restore it to a stable, level position without the need for full replacement. Homeowners often seek foam jacking services to address issues caused by soil erosion, settling, or frost heave, which can lead to tripping hazards, water drainage problems, or damage to property.

Before requesting foam jacking, property owners typically want to understand the extent of the sinking or unevenness, the areas that can be effectively lifted, and the longevity of the repair. It’s also helpful to know whether the existing concrete is suitable for foam jacking and if any preparation is needed prior to the service. This method is generally suitable for minor to moderate settling, making it a practical solution for restoring safety and appearance to various concrete surfaces.

Foam Jacking Questions

What is foam jacking? Foam jacking is a method used to lift and stabilize sunken or uneven concrete slabs using a specialized foam material.

What types of projects can benefit from foam jacking? It is commonly used for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ors that have settled or shifted over time.

How does foam jacking work? A foam mixture is injected beneath the concrete to raise it to the desired level and provide support, preventing further sinking.

Is foam jacking a permanent solution? Foam jacking can provide long-lasting stabilization, especially when combined with proper drainage and soil assessment.
